Gravel biking in Västra Bosjöklosterhalvön features varied terrain across a peninsula characterized by woodlands, open landscapes, and views of local lakes. The region is known for ancient oak trees and diverse ecosystems, including bushy wet woodlands of alder, ash, and birch. The terrain includes both forest trails and paths that navigate the natural environment. This area offers a mix of flat sections and gentle inclines suitable for gravel bikes.

Best gravel bike trails in Västra Bosjöklosterhalvön

  • The most popular gravel bike trail is Ekastiga loop from Höör, a 16.8 miles (27.0 km) trail that takes 2 hours 20 minutes to complete. This route features varied terrain suitable for gravel bikes.
  • Another top favourite among local gravel bikers is View of the Lake – Skånes Djurpark loop from Höör, a moderate 23.5 miles (37.8 km) path. It leads through varied landscapes and offers scenic views.
  • Local gravel bikers also love the Skånes Djurpark – Windshelter Dagstorp loop from Höör, a 14.2 miles (22.9 km) trail leading through woodlands and open areas, often completed in about 1 hour 29 minutes.

December 18, 2025, Tjörnarp Church

Tjörnarp Church is a striking 19th-century landmark in Tjörnarp, built in 1864 with a distinctive golden-ochre plaster finish over grey stone. It stands near the ruins of the original medieval church, offering a fascinating historical contrast. A key highlight is stepping inside to see the 12th-century sandstone baptismal font preserved from the old church that connects the current building to its ancient roots.

December 18, 2025, View of the Lake

This view of Lake Tjörnarpa is a scenic spot that offers calming views across the water, framed by lush beech forests and reed beds that are home to a variety of waterfowl, including grebes and herons. It is a perfect place to pause for a rest or a swim at this bathing area.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many gravel bike trails are available in Västra Bosjöklosterhalvön?

There are currently 7 gravel bike routes documented on komoot for Västra Bosjöklosterhalvön, offering a variety of experiences across the peninsula.

What is the typical difficulty level of gravel bike trails in Västra Bosjöklosterhalvön?

The gravel bike trails in Västra Bosjöklosterhalvön primarily range from moderate to difficult. Most routes are classified as moderate, with one challenging option available for experienced riders.

What kind of landscapes can I expect on these gravel bike routes?

You can expect a diverse mix of woodlands, open fields, and scenic views of local lakes. The terrain is varied, making it well-suited for gravel bikes as you explore the natural environment of the peninsula.

Are there any loop gravel bike routes in the area?

Yes, many of the gravel bike routes in Västra Bosjöklosterhalvön are loops. For example, you can explore the Ekastiga loop from Höör or the longer View of the Lake – Bosarpssjön Beach loop from Höör.

Where can I find parking for gravel biking in Västra Bosjöklosterhalvön?

Many routes start from Höör, which is a central point in the region. You can typically find parking facilities in and around Höör, serving as convenient starting points for your gravel biking adventures.

Is it possible to reach the gravel bike trails by public transport?

Höör is well-connected by public transport, including train services. You can travel to Höör station and start your gravel bike tour from there, as many routes are accessible from the town.

What do other gravel bikers say about the trails in Västra Bosjöklosterhalvön?

The routes in Västra Bosjöklosterhalvön are highly rated by the komoot community, with an average score of 5.0 stars from over 5 reviews. Users often praise the varied terrain and scenic lake views.

What is the best time of year for gravel biking in Västra Bosjöklosterhalvön?

The best time for gravel biking is generally from spring to autumn (April to October), when the weather is milder and the trails are dry. The natural landscapes are particularly beautiful during these seasons.

Can I go gravel biking in Västra Bosjöklosterhalvön during winter?

While possible, winter gravel biking in Västra Bosjöklosterhalvön can be challenging due to colder temperatures, potential snow, and shorter daylight hours. It's advisable to check local weather conditions and trail status before heading out, and ensure you have appropriate gear.

Are there any longer gravel bike routes for experienced riders?

Yes, for those looking for a longer challenge, the View of the Lake – Bosarpssjön Beach loop from Höör covers approximately 62.3 km and offers extensive scenic views, making it suitable for experienced riders.

Are there any shorter gravel bike routes for a quicker ride?

If you're looking for a shorter ride, the Skånes Djurpark – Windshelter Dagstorp loop from Höör is a moderate 23.1 km route that can be completed in a shorter timeframe, offering a good taste of the region's gravel trails.

Are there any cafes or places to stop for refreshments along the routes?

While specific cafes directly on every trail are not guaranteed, routes often start or pass through areas like Höör or near attractions such as Skånes Djurpark, where you can find options for refreshments and breaks.
